Finding Solace in a Mother's Voice: The Heartfelt Journey of 'I Called Mama'

Tim McGraw's song 'I Called Mama' is a poignant reflection on the importance of family, the fragility of life, and the comfort found in simple, heartfelt connections. The song begins with the narrator receiving devastating news about a friend, which serves as a wake-up call, prompting him to reevaluate what truly matters in life. This moment of clarity leads him to seek solace in familiar, comforting rituals—stopping at a Texaco, buying a Slim Jim and a Coke, and spending time by the water. These actions symbolize a return to simpler times and a grounding in the present moment.

The act of calling his mother becomes a central theme in the song, representing a deep emotional connection and the timeless comfort of a mother's love. The narrator's decision to call his mom is not just about seeking comfort but also about expressing love and appreciation. The lyrics capture the warmth and reassurance that comes from hearing a loved one's voice, especially in times of distress. This phone call is a reminder of the importance of staying connected with family and cherishing those relationships.

Throughout the song, McGraw emphasizes the need to prioritize what truly matters and not to take loved ones for granted. The repetition of the ritual—stopping at the Texaco, buying a Slim Jim and a Coke, and calling his mom—serves as a metaphor for the small, meaningful actions that can bring peace and clarity. The song's message is clear: life is unpredictable, and it's essential to make time for the people and moments that bring joy and comfort. 'I Called Mama' is a touching reminder to appreciate the simple, yet profound, connections that shape our lives.
